Consecutively Serialized.

Cased Pair of Colt 125th Anniversary Single Action Army Revolvers.

Serial no's. 6206AM and 6207AM, .45 calibers, 7 1/2-inch barrels with fixed front blade sights and frame notch rear sights. Blued finish. Left sides of barrels marked: 125TH ANNIVERSARY S.A.A. MODEL .45 CAL. Two-line, three-date patents and Rampant Colt logos to left side of frames. Gold-plated hammers, triggers and gripstraps. Smooth walnut grip panels with inlaid Colt medallions. Contained in fitted wood display case with red felt lining. Sold along with receipt from Jackson Arms (Dallas, TX), dated July 15, 1977. The Colt 125th Anniversary Single Action Army (SAA) is a special, limited-edition commemorative revolver released by Colt's Manufacturing Company in 1961 to celebrate the 125th anniversary of the founding of Colt.

Condition: Very good to excellent. Overall showing light handling wear. Some scattered scuffs and dings present to wood. Actions crisp. Bores bright. Display case showing light storage wear. From the Collection of James Schubert.
